Man, son attacked on Diwali night after firecrackers row

An Anna Catherina man and his son were severely beaten on Thursday night after a row with two men who were throwing firecrackers in front of their gap.

As a result of the attack, the Guyana Police Force said Michael Anthony, known as ‘Rakash,’ 46, had to get medical treatment, while son, 16, was admitted at the West Demerara Regional Hospital for surgery.

In a press release, the police said Anthony was at the front of his yard when he noticed the two men throwing fire crackers in front of his gap. It was reported that he approached them and told them to desist, which eventually led to an exchange of words and a physical altercation.
